Here is a little simple Andy Warhol style baby card. I distressed the yellow layer using my fingernail. Methinks, one card a day using the fingernail tech is all, as the finger gets a bit sore!

A comment on the StazOn Butter Cream inkpad. It is divine on acetate as it stamps a really rich cream! Very yummy. As you can see here, it stamps quite yellow on white matt card! So I am thinking, I have two for the price of one. The Opaque series in StazOn are a very interesting set of inkpads! The Flamingo cardstock IRL matches the the Rose Coral inkpad. It just doesn't scan the right colour.
